Cooking Tips and Notes for Carrot Walnut Cake
Creating the perfect carrot walnut cake is not just about following the recipe; it’s an adventure into the world of flavors and textures. With a few helpful tips, you can elevate your baking game.
Choosing the Right Carrots
Using fresh, vibrant carrots is key for a flavorful cake. Grate them finely for better distribution throughout the batter. I prefer using a box grater or food processor for quick and easy grating. Not only does this enhance the moisture content, but it also ensures the carrots blend seamlessly into the cake.
Selecting Your Walnuts
Chopped walnuts add a delightful crunch. Toasting the walnuts beforehand can intensify their flavor significantly. A quick trip to a dry skillet over medium heat for 5-7 minutes will awaken their nutty richness. Just keep a close eye, as they can go from perfectly toasted to burnt in a flash!
Mind Your Mixing
When combining your wet and dry ingredients, mix until just combined. Overmixing can lead to a dense cake—nobody wants that. Gently incorporate the ingredients, making sure not to leave any dry patches. This ensures a light and fluffy texture.
Cooling Time Matters
Allow the carrot walnut cake to cool in the pan for about 15 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ack. This helps prevent breakage and keeps the cake from becoming soggy. Patience is a virtue here; the cooling process is vital for flavor development.

Carrot Cake
- Total Time: 50 minutes
- Yield: 8 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A delicious and moist carrot cake that’s per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
- 1 cup all pur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up + 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1/2 cup packed light brown sugar
- 1/4 cup + 2 tablespoons white s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 large eggs
- 2 cups coarsely grated carrots (about 3 medium)
- 3/4 cup finely chopped walnuts
- 1/4 cup golden raisins (optional)
Instructions
-
Preheat oven to 350° F (177°C) and grease an 8-inch square or round baking pan with cooking spray and line the bottom with parchment paper.
-
Add all dry ingredients into a medium bowl and whisk to combine.
-
Add all wet ingredients (except eggs) into a larger bowl and whisk for about 1 minute, until thoroughly combined. Add both eggs and whisk until blended well.
-
Switch to a rubber spatula and stir in dry ingredients, grated carrots, walnuts and raisins, until evenly combined.
-
Transfer batter into the prepared cake pan, spread evenly and bake for 30 to 35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the middle comes clean.
-
Place the pan on a wire rack to cool completely. Slice and enjoy!
Notes
- Carrots can be grated using a box grater or a food processor.
- Ensure the eggs are at room temperature for better emulsification.
